A Deep Dive into Ad Formats

Instead of blindly burning through your budget, it’s crucial to understand the mechanics of each format in AdsCompass. The platform offers both classic and premium placement options:

Popunder (Pop): The go-to format for reaching a broad audience and generating massive click volumes. The user clicks anywhere on the publisher’s site, and your landing page opens in a new or background tab. This is where the loading speed of your pre-lander and an aggressive call-to-action are decisive factors.

Push Notifications: A timeless classic. Works great for user retention and reminders. Traffic is divided into activity levels – always start your tests with high-activity users.

In-Page Push: These look like system notifications directly on the website. The main advantage is that they work on iOS and don’t require user subscription, easily bypassing banner blindness.

Video Pre-roll: Short promotional videos that play in the video player before the main content starts. The format supports VAST/VPAID standards. This is an absolute must-have for iGaming, Betting, and Dating, where conveying emotion and visual demonstration are critical. Grab attention in the first 3 seconds to get high-quality leads.


Telegram Ads (TMA – Mini Apps): The hottest trend right now. Ads are integrated directly into internal Telegram Mini Apps. Given the boom in clicker games, this is the perfect spot for crypto offers and iGaming.


Native Ads & Banners: Native blocks that adapt to the design of the host site. Suitable for e-commerce, nutra, and financial offers where warming up the user through a teaser approach is important.
Campaign Setup and Bidding Strategy

The Self-Serve platform’s interface is logical and intuitive. Launching a campaign consists of a few straightforward steps:
Choose the Format and Pricing Model: Decide what you are paying for – CPC or CPM. CPC is mostly used for Push, while CPM is standard for Pops and Video.
-GEO Setup and Bidding: Select your target country. The platform immediately displays a recommended bid to get an optimal volume of traffic. Start slightly above average so the algorithm can quickly spend your test budget and gather data.
-Detailed Targeting: Always separate your campaigns into Mobile and Desktop. For mobile offers, you can target specific mobile network operators.
-Creatives: For push ads, the system allows you to upload an icon, main image, title, and text. It’s recommended to upload 3-5 different creatives into one campaign for A/B testing.
-Setting Limits: Always set a daily limit and a total campaign limit to avoid draining your budget in a matter of hours.
Analytics and Data Optimization
Running campaigns on such networks is pointless without deep analytics. AdsCompass provides powerful tools for performance tracking:
S2S Postback Integration: The platform easily integrates with all popular trackers like Keitaro, Voluum, and Binom. Setting up a postback allows you to send conversion data back to the ad network.
Using Macros: You can dynamically pass parameters into your offer URL to track the zone ID, campaign ID, and cost.
Black and White Lists: Based on your tracker’s data, you can see which zones bring in leads and which just drain your budget. Bad zones go to the blacklist, and top-performing zones should be moved to a separate whitelist campaign with a higher bid.
